modsf poster
Design influenced by the works of glass-blower Josiah McElheny. The piece is a glass box consisting of four mirrored walls. The facade facing the viewer is a one way mirror allowing the viewer to see inside the glass box. Contained within the box is a glass and resin spherical globe. The dimensional piece was created as promotion for Michael Osborne of MODSF. read more

mannequin poster series
This series of posters was developed through the inspiration of the fashion students attending Miami International University of Art and Design. They had been given an assignment to make evening gowns entirely out of the Miami Herald newspaper. I photographed the gowns and began incorporating the photography into a design.

pop-up postcard series
This series was inspired by the paintings and illustrations of Henri de Toulouse-Lautrec (1864-1901) and Coles Phillips (1880-1920). The result of this union is a whimsical series of postcards in fresh colors and toned with punchy dialogue. Cute phrases like “How do I look?” and “I’m a very stylish gurl!” cater to the playful character of the imagery. Each card has an element of interaction utilizing pop-ups.
